Understanding the Basics: Ratios, Percentages, and Their Applications

Comparing quantities means figuring out how one amount relates to another. The simplest way to do this is using Ratios and Percentages.

Ratios: A ratio compares two quantities of the same kind by division. For example, if there are 10 boys and 15 girls in a class, the ratio of boys to girls is 10:15, which simplifies to 2:3. This means for every 2 boys, there are 3 girls. Ratios help us understand relative sizes.

Percentages: A percentage means 'out of one hundred'. It's a special type of ratio where the second term is always 100. For example, 75% means 75 out of 100, or 75/100. Percentages are incredibly useful for comparing different quantities, even if their total amounts are different. Imagine scoring 40 out of 50 in Science and 75 out of 100 in Maths. Which is better? Converting to percentages:

  • Science: (40/50) * 100% = 80%
  • Maths: (75/100) * 100% = 75%

So, 80% in Science is better than 75% in Maths. Percentages make comparisons clear and easy. They are widely used in calculating profit/loss, discounts, interest rates, and even in reporting statistics.

Converting Fractions/Decimals to Percentages:

  • To convert a fraction to a percentage, multiply by 100. Example: 3/4 = (3/4) * 100% = 75%.
  • To convert a decimal to a percentage, multiply by 100. Example: 0.25 = 0.25 * 100% = 25%.

Converting Percentages to Fractions/Decimals:

  • To convert a percentage to a fraction, divide by 100. Example: 60% = 60/100 = 3/5.
  • To convert a percentage to a decimal, divide by 100. Example: 60% = 60/100 = 0.60.

Understanding these foundational concepts is crucial before moving on to more complex applications like profit, loss, and interest.

Step-by-Step: Profit, Loss, Discount, and Simple Interest

  1. Calculating Profit and Loss — Profit or Loss is determined by comparing the Cost Price (CP), which is the price at which an item is bought, with the Selling Price (SP), the price at which it is sold. Step 1: Identify CP and SP. If SP > CP, there is a Profit. Profit = SP - CP. If CP > SP, there is a Loss. Loss = CP - SP. Step 2: Calculate Profit % or Loss % (always on CP). Profit % = (Profit / CP) × 100 Loss % = (Loss / CP) × 100 Example: A shopkeeper buys a toy for ₹150 (CP) and sells it for ₹180 (SP). Since SP > CP, it's a Profit. Profit = ₹180 - ₹150 = ₹30. Profit % = (₹30 / ₹150) × 100 = (1/5) × 100 = 20%.
  2. Calculating Discount and Sales Tax (GST) — When an item is sold, its price can be affected by discounts or additional taxes like GST. Step 1: Understand Marked Price (MP) and Discount. Marked Price (MP) is the price tagged on the item. Discount is the reduction offered on the MP. Discount is always calculated on the MP. Discount = Discount % of MP. Step 2: Find Selling Price (SP) after Discount. SP = MP - Discount. Step 3: Add Sales Tax (GST). Sales Tax/GST is calculated on the selling price after discount. Tax Amount = Tax % of SP. Final Price = SP + Tax Amount. Example: A shirt is marked at ₹800. A discount of 10% is offered, and GST is 12%. Discount = 10% of ₹800 = (10/100) × 800 = ₹80. SP after discount = ₹800 - ₹80 = ₹720. GST Amount = 12% of ₹720 = (12/100) × 720 = ₹86.40. * Final Price = ₹720 + ₹86.40 = ₹806.40.
  3. Calculating Simple Interest — Interest is the extra money paid by the borrower to the lender for using their money. Simple Interest (SI) is calculated only on the original principal amount. Step 1: Identify Principal (P), Rate (R), and Time (T). Principal (P): The initial amount of money borrowed or deposited. Rate (R): The interest rate per annum (per year), usually given as a percentage. Time (T): The duration for which the money is borrowed or deposited, in years. Step 2: Use the Simple Interest Formula. Simple Interest (SI) = (P × R × T) / 100 Step 3: Calculate the Amount. Amount (A) = Principal (P) + Simple Interest (SI). Example: Calculate the simple interest on ₹5000 at 8% per annum for 3 years. P = ₹5000, R = 8%, T = 3 years. SI = (5000 × 8 × 3) / 100 = (50 × 8 × 3) = ₹1200. Amount = ₹5000 + ₹1200 = ₹6200.

Exam Tips and Avoiding Common Mistakes

To excel in 'Comparing Quantities', always pay close attention to the details in the problem statement. Here are some key tips and common pitfalls to avoid:

  1. Read Carefully: Many mistakes happen because students misinterpret what's asked. Is it profit or loss? Is the rate per annum or per month? Are you finding the percentage increase or the new amount?
  2. Units Consistency: Ensure all quantities being compared or used in calculations have the same units. If you're comparing 500 grams to 2 kilograms, convert kilograms to grams (2 kg = 2000 g) before forming a ratio.
  3. Base for Percentage: Remember, profit and loss percentages are always calculated on the Cost Price (CP), unless specified otherwise. Discount is always calculated on the Marked Price (MP).
  4. Time in Years: For Simple Interest, the 'Time' (T) must always be in years. If given in months, convert to years (e.g., 6 months = 6/12 = 0.5 years).
  5. Compound Interest vs. Simple Interest: Understand the fundamental difference. Simple interest is calculated only on the principal, while compound interest is calculated on the principal plus accumulated interest from previous periods. Class 8 mainly focuses on simple interest, but it's good to know the distinction.
  6. Step-by-Step Approach: Break down complex problems into smaller, manageable steps. For example, first calculate discount, then SP, then GST. This prevents errors and makes your solution clear.

Practice Questions with Solutions

  • Q: A basket contains 30 oranges and 20 apples. Find the ratio of apples to oranges and the percentage of apples in the basket. A: Step 1: Find the ratio of apples to oranges. Number of apples = 20 Number of oranges = 30 Ratio of apples to oranges = 20:30 = 2:3 Step 2: Calculate the total number of fruits. Total fruits = 30 + 20 = 50 Step 3: Calculate the percentage of apples. Percentage of apples = (Number of apples / Total fruits) 100 Percentage of apples = (20 / 50) 100 = (2/5) * 100 = 40% Final answer: The ratio of apples to oranges is 2:3, and the percentage of apples in the basket is 40%.
  • Q: A shopkeeper bought a cycle for ₹3500 and spent ₹500 on its repairs. He then sold it for ₹4500. Find his profit or loss percentage. A: Step 1: Calculate the total Cost Price (CP). Initial cost = ₹3500 Repair cost = ₹500 Total CP = ₹3500 + ₹500 = ₹4000 Step 2: Identify the Selling Price (SP). SP = ₹4500 Step 3: Determine if there is a profit or loss. Since SP (₹4500) > CP (₹4000), there is a profit. Profit = SP - CP = ₹4500 - ₹4000 = ₹500 Step 4: Calculate the profit percentage. Profit % = (Profit / CP) 100 Profit % = (₹500 / ₹4000) 100 = (1/8) * 100 = 12.5% Final answer: The shopkeeper made a profit of 12.5%.
  • Q: An item is marked at ₹1200. A discount of 20% is offered on it. Calculate the selling price of the item. A: Step 1: Identify the Marked Price (MP) and Discount Percentage. MP = ₹1200 Discount % = 20% Step 2: Calculate the discount amount. Discount = 20% of MP = (20/100) * ₹1200 = ₹240 Step 3: Calculate the Selling Price (SP). SP = MP - Discount = ₹1200 - ₹240 = ₹960 Final answer: The selling price of the item is ₹960.
  • Q: Find the simple interest on a principal of ₹8000 at a rate of 5% per annum for 4 years. Also, find the total amount. A: Step 1: Identify the Principal (P), Rate (R), and Time (T). P = ₹8000 R = 5% per annum T = 4 years Step 2: Calculate the Simple Interest (SI) using the formula SI = (P × R × T) / 100. SI = (₹8000 × 5 × 4) / 100 SI = (80 × 5 × 4) = 400 × 4 = ₹1600 Step 3: Calculate the total Amount (A). Amount = Principal + Simple Interest Amount = ₹8000 + ₹1600 = ₹9600 Final answer: The simple interest is ₹1600, and the total amount is ₹9600.

Frequently Asked Questions

What is the main idea behind 'Comparing Quantities'?

The main idea is to understand how different amounts relate to each other, often expressed using ratios, percentages, or as financial metrics like profit/loss and interest. It helps us make sense of numerical information in real-world scenarios.

Why are percentages so important in this chapter?

Percentages provide a standardized way to compare parts of a whole, even when the totals are different. They simplify comparisons and are fundamental for calculating profit, loss, discounts, and interest, making them a crucial tool in everyday financial calculations.

What is the difference between Cost Price (CP) and Marked Price (MP)?

Cost Price (CP) is the actual price a shopkeeper pays to buy an item. Marked Price (MP) is the price written on the item, which can be higher than the CP, and from which discounts are usually offered to customers.

How does Simple Interest differ from Compound Interest?

Simple Interest is calculated only on the original principal amount for the entire duration. Compound Interest, on the other hand, is calculated on the principal *plus* the accumulated interest from previous periods, leading to faster growth of the amount.
